## Changelog — Stagewright Seat-Map Renderer v2.14.0

### Key rotation

The artifact signing key for the Stagewright renderer, used by the Pellbrook Theatre deployment, was rotated on schedule this release. All seat-map bundle artifacts from v2.14.0 onward carry signatures from the new key. The previous key is revoked effective immediately; builds signed with it will fail verification. New team members should import the replacement into their toolchain. The new signing key appears below.

deploy key for yajop-fahop: bky3_h1v

**Management Meeting Minutes – Headcount Planning**

Attendees: Dept heads, chaired by Marta Veil.

Quick recap: next year's headcount plan was walked through line by line. Engineering at Brindlewood gets six new roles; Ops stays flat. Priya flagged that the Kestrel Suite launch may need contractors in Q2 — noted, not yet budgeted. Final numbers go to Finance by the 15th, so get your requests in early. One sensitive point came up that needs flagging here.

confidential, bawig-bajeg: Headcount on the Oliix team goes from 5 to 80 by the end of January. Gross margin on Oliix came in at 10 percent against a plan of 20 percent.

# Sweeper settings for the Driftwood orphaned-resource sweeper.
# Discussed at the weekly eng sync: the sweeper scans for volumes,
# snapshots, and DNS records with no owning deployment, then marks
# them for deletion after a 72-hour grace window. Dry-run mode is on
# by default. The sweeper tracks candidates in the registry reached
# via the connection string below.

replica DSN, yahaf-yagaf: mongodb://tamath_svc:a2netSk3RZMuTj@db-d084.novacsoft.internal:5432/ralmir

## Changelog — 2.9.0 key rotation

Hey newcomers! Quick note on this release: we rotated the signing key used by Snapshotter, our UI component snapshot testing harness. Old baselines signed with the retired key will fail verification, so regenerate them with `snap refresh --all` before your first run. Nothing else changed in the diffing engine, promise. The new verification key you'll want in your local config is below.

signing key of bagap-yawep = bky13_TbfT6ZMUoGJo2